Mowins covers all the bases in a grueling 18-day, multi-sport road trip

Last month, ESPN play-by-play announcer Beth Mowins set out on an 18-day road trip which involved seven telecasts across five events.

Even more amazing, Mowins will play a part in presenting four sports in a 12-day period. (See her complete itinerary at the bottom of this post.)

She is currently in the home stretch heading to the NCAA Women’s College Cup soccer championships in Kennesaw, Ga. this weekend.

A self-proclaimed “America’s Houseguest,” Mowins had 13 nights in hotels, was fortunate to spend three nights with friends for the holiday break and was at home for just two nights in San Diego during that time span.

She’s logged many miles flying and driving — swinging through seven airports and trekking to those out of the way college campuses by car.

Mowins said: “It has been a thoroughly enjoyable journey with relatively easy travel so far (fingers crossed), despite the time zone changes and sports shifts. The weather has been cooperative and the check-in lines have been short at the airport, hotels and rental car counters. I am a little worried my luck will run out soon.

“It was challenge to figure out what to wear, how to do game research on the road and to actually know, what city I was in! But I wouldn’t trade it for the world: There is nothing better than the human drama of athletics, especially as I head to the national championship in soccer this weekend. It’s the real, reality TV.”

Mowins’ Schedule: 18 Days, 7 Games, 5 Events/12 Days, 4 Sports

Nov. 17 Fly from San Diego (home) to O’Hare to Champaign
Nov. 18 Prep Day in Champaign, Ill.
Nov. 19 EVENT # 1: No. 17 Wisconsin at Illinois football (ESPN2 & ESPN3, Noon), Fly from O’Hare to Hartford, Conn.
Nov. 20 Prep Day in Hartford, Conn.
Nov. 21 EVENT # 2: No. 5 Stanford at No. 4 Connecticut (ESPNU, 7 p.m.)
Nov. 22 Drive from Hartford, Conn. to Syracuse, N.Y. (hometown) for Thanksgiving
Nov. 25 Drive to Hartford, Conn. from Syracuse, N.Y. for a prep day
Nov. 26 EVENT # 3: Rutgers at Connecticut football (ESPN2, Noon), Fly from Hartford, Conn. to Charlotte
Nov. 27 EVENT # 4: NCAA Volleyball Selection Show (ESPNU, 6 p.m.)
Nov. 28 Fly from Charlotte to San Diego (home)
Nov. 30 Fly from San Diego to Atlanta
Dec. 1 Prep Day in Kennesaw, Ga.
Dec. 2 EVENT # 5/6: Women’s College Cup Semifinals
(ESPNU, 5 p.m./ESPN3, 7:30 p.m. & ESPNU tape delay on 12/4)
Dec. 4 EVENT #7: Women’s College Cup Final (ESPNU, 1 p.m.)
Fly from Atlanta to San Diego (home)
